Hybrid revenue streams refer to a business model that combines multiple sources of income, allowing organizations to diversify their revenue and reduce dependency on a single source. This approach is crucial in the global media landscape, as it enables media companies to blend traditional income methods like advertising and subscriptions with newer methods such as digital content sales, crowdfunding, or events, enhancing financial stability and growth potential.
